yii框架配置默认controller和action示例

网络编程 2025-03-14 18:00www.168986.cn编程入门

Yii框架:设置默认Controller与Action示例指南

对于想要在Yii框架中设置默认controller和action的朋友们,下面是一个简单的配置示例。

一、设置默认Controller

打开你的项目中的配置文件,路径为`/protected/config/main.php`。在这个文件中,你可以添加如下代码来设置默认的Controller:

```php

return array(

'name' => 'YourApp', // 你的应用名称

'defaultController' => 'auto', // 设置默认的Controller为AutoController.php

// 其他配置...

);

```

这样,你就成功地将默认的Controller设置为`AutoController.php`了。

二、设置默认Action

接下来,打开你刚刚设置的`AutoController.php`文件。在这个文件中,你可以通过以下方式设置默认的action:

```php

class AutoController extends CController {

public $defaultAction = 'test'; // 设置默认的action为test

public function actionTest() {

// 这里是你的actionTest的逻辑代码

// ...

}

// 其他action...

}

```

完成以上设置后,当你访问你的网站时,例如`/index.php`,系统将会默认将你引导到`/index.php?r=auto/test`。也就是说,当你没有指定具体的controller和action时,系统将使用你设置的默认controller和action。

这个配置过程相对简单,对于熟悉Yii框架的朋友来说应该很容易理解。如果你有任何疑问或者需要进一步的帮助,请随时提问。希望这个指南对你有所帮助!如果你还有其他关于Yii框架的问题,欢迎随时参考其他相关资料或者向我提问。

上一篇:TSYS资源特性的效率提高方法 下一篇:没有了

Copyright © 2016-2025 www.168986.cn 狼蚁网络 版权所有 Power by